Introduction to BunsenLabs Linux
BunsenLabs Linux is a Debian‑based distribution focused on providing a fast, minimal, and highly customizable desktop environment. It is designed for users who value performance without sacrificing stability and the broad compatibility of Debian packages. Its default desktop uses the Openbox window manager together with the tint2 panel, resulting in very low resource consumption.
History and origin
The project was born in 2015 as a fork of CrunchBang Linux, whose community decided to continue development after the announcement of its demise. The developers took the Debian Jessie base and adapted it to preserve the simplicity and efficiency philosophy that characterized CrunchBang. Since then, BunsenLabs has evolved with releases based on Debian Stretch, Buster, and Bullseye, always retaining its original principles.
Philosophy and design
The philosophy of BunsenLabs is summed up in three pillars: lightness, clarity, and community. The team avoids including unnecessary software and prefers to offer a basic system that the user can adapt to their needs. The visual design is sober, with dark and light themes that favor concentration and reduce eye strain. Each component is chosen for its low memory and CPU consumption, allowing the distribution to run comfortably on old hardware or in virtual machines with limited resources.
Technical features
BunsenLabs includes by default a carefully selected set of tools:
- Openbox window manager, highly configurable via simple text files.
- tint2 panel with launchers, clock, and system tray, fully customizable.
- Application menu based on obmenu-generator, providing quick access to programs and settings.
- Terminator terminal emulator, ideal for users working with multiple sessions.
- Thunar file manager, lightweight and easy to use.
- PulseAudio sound controller and NetworkManager network manager for a complete desktop experience.
Additionally, the system includes the meta‑packages bunsen-laptops and bunsen-desktop that ease the installation of drivers and utilities specific to laptops and desktop machines.
Installation and requirements
Installation follows the standard Debian process using a graphical installer based on debian-installer. A machine with at least 512 MB of RAM and 5 GB of disk space is recommended, though for a comfortable experience 1 GB of RAM and 10 GB of disk are suggested. The installation medium can be a hybrid ISO image that can be written to USB or burned to a DVD. During the process the user can choose from several desktop options, including Openbox, Fluxbox, or i3, although the default variant is the lightest.
Customization and themes
One of BunsenLabs’ greatest strengths is the ease of customization. Users can modify the appearance of the tint2 panel by editing its configuration file ~/.config/tint2/tint2rc, change Openbox themes via the obconf manager, or install new icons and fonts from the Debian repositories. Moreover, the community maintains a set of scripts and themes called bunsen-themes that allow the overall look of the system to be changed quickly with a single command.
Community and support
BunsenLabs has an active community that gathers on forums, mailing lists, and IRC channels. The official site provides detailed documentation, troubleshooting guides, and a wiki where tips and advanced configurations are collected. Although it lacks the backing of a large company, the open development model ensures that any user can contribute patches, improvements, or new packages.
Conclusion
BunsenLabs Linux represents an excellent choice for those seeking a Debian‑based operating system that is fast, stable, and fully adaptable to their needs. Its focus on lightness and clarity makes it ideal for old hardware, virtual machines, or simply for users who prefer an environment free of bloatware. If you value the freedom to customize every detail without sacrificing the solidity of Debian, BunsenLabs deserves serious consideration.
This post is also available in ESPAÑOL.